The African Development Bank (“AfDB”) is a regional multilateral development bank whose shareholders include the 54 countries in Africa and 27 non-African countries from the Americas, Asia, and Europe. The Bank was established in 1964 with its headquarters in Abidjan Cote d’Ivoire. The Bank’s primary objective is to promote the economic development and social progress of its regional member countries, individually and jointly. The central goal of the Bank’s activities is promoting sustainable growth and reducing poverty in Africa. The Bank thus finances a broad range of development projects and programs.

Brief Description of the Assignment

  • Under the general supervision of the Financial Intermediation and Inclusion (PIFD.1) Division Manager, We have the pleasure to inform you that the African Development Bank Group (‘AfDB’ or the ‘Bank’) will require the Services of a Private Sector Development and Investment Specialist hereafter the ‘Consultant’ to support in the origination of new financial sector investments across Africa; processing of ongoing operations as well as other projects and initiatives of the Division’s growing business operations and activities in support of financial sector development in Africa.

Job Brief

  • The primary role of the Financial Sector Development (PIFD) Department is to help the Regional Member Countries (RMCs) increase the reach, depth, and breadth of their financial systems, while safeguarding financial stability. The Department has four long-term objectives:
    • Development of a vibrant private sector through an inclusive access by households and enterprises to financial services;
    • Strengthening markets participants;
    • Developing efficient capital markets, and
    • Deepening regional financial integration.
  • Financial Intermediation and Inclusion Division (PIFD1) focuses on supporting and developing financial intermediaries by promoting innovative financial and nonfinancial products and services that are responsive to the needs of Bank’s clients in a bit to boost and increase access to finance and financial services by private enterprises including African SMEs, as well as other underserved sectors and populations such as Women and Youth.
  • PIFD1 requires the services of a Consultant to support the Investment Team in originating, appraising and processing of financial sector investments across Africa, partnering with local financial institutions and introducing (new) financing instruments, in order to develop efficient financial systems that will increase financial inclusion and fuel economic growth.

Duties and Scope of Work
Under the overall guidance of the Manager – Financial Intermediation and Inclusion Division (PIFD1) and under the immediate supervision of the assigned Task Manager(s), the consultant will be required to perform the following duties:

  • Participating in or leading the preliminary evaluation of both lending and non-lending projects. This involves the initial screening of project applications, carrying out of desk reviews and evaluation of feasibility studies, preparing preliminary evaluation notes for presentation to the Department Management Team and more detailed project concept notes to obtain concept clearance for full appraisal or fact-finding missions;
  • Participating in the planning and execution of appraisal and fact-finding missions. This includes developing terms of reference for the mission, monitoring the work of the mission team, and carrying out independent research. The work also includes assessing the risks of projects and advising on appropriate structure or conducting preliminary negotiations with sponsors;
  • Preparing project appraisal reports for presentation to the Department, the various review committees and finally to the Board of Directors;
  • Ensuring that all conditions precedent have been fulfilled on a timely basis and all fees are billed and collected from clients;
  • Developing relationships within the Bank and with other institutions involved in financial markets development; Participate in seminars, workshops and conferences dealing with financial markets issues;
  • Coordinating closely with social environmental, and technical assistance colleagues in order to add value to our clients’ businesses, find pragmatic solutions to the specific sector challenges, and achieve sustainable development impact;
  • Assist in integrity due diligence for potential clients;
  • Building and maintaining strong relationships with clients, global and regional private businesses, banking and multilateral partners to deepen the financial sector and to develop specific investment opportunities;
  • Any other duties as may be assigned by the Manager, PIFD1.
